>>18977926
Sure, here' some more info for you.
The beer was mashed with about 5 pounds of roasted Pennsylvania longneck pumpkin. After a week of fermenting I added another 5 pounds of roasted longneck pumpkin that was then lightly caramelized in maple syrup and molasses. The yeast activity instantly restarted after I added the warm pumpkin to the fermenter. I bottled it about a week later and swirled in just a little homemade vanilla extract (vanilla beans soaked in bourbon).
Here are the ingredients:
>Omega Saison yeast
>Hallertau hops
>American two-row barley
>Special B roasted malt
>Munich malt
>~5 pounds of Pennsylvania longneck pumpkin (roasted and caramelized)
>Brown sugar
>Fresh ground baking spices (nutmeg, clove, cinnamon, ginger)
>Just a drop of homemade vanilla extract (Madagascar vanilla beans soaked in high-proof bourbon)
